在Java中表示x的y次方
在Java中,我们可以使用Math类中的pow方法来表示一个数的幂次方。pow方法的签名如下:
public static double pow(double x, double y)
其中x为底数,y为指数。返回值为x的y次方。
下面是一个使用Math.pow方法计算x的y次方的示例代码:
public class PowerExample {
public static void main(String[] args) {
double x = 2.0;
double y = 3.0;
double result = Math.pow(x, y);
System.out.println(x + "的" + y + "次方是:" + result);
}
}
上述代码中,我们定义了一个PowerExample类,其中的main方法用于执行代码。我们将底数x设为2.0,指数y设为3.0,然后调用Math.pow方法计算x的y次方,并将结果存储在result变量中。最后,我们使用System.out.println方法打印出计算结果。
运行以上代码,输出结果为:
2.0的3.0次方是:8.0
类图
下面是PowerExample类的类图:
classDiagram
PowerExample -- Math
在类图中,PowerExample类依赖于Math类来调用pow方法。
总结
在Java中,我们可以使用Math类的pow方法来表示一个数的幂次方。通过传递底数和指数作为参数,我们可以得到底数的指定次方结果。在以上示例中,我们展示了如何使用Math.pow方法计算x的y次方,并打印出结果。希望本文对你有所帮助!